Apple’s latest software update for the firmware of the USB-C to MagSafe charging cable

Apple’s latest software update for the USB-C to MagSafe 3 Charging Cable, build number 10M1543, promises to improve the device’s performance and security. The update is specifically for the MacBook Air M2 and the 14-inch and 16-inch MacBook Pro models that were launched in 2021 and 2022.

Technology devices and accessories require firmware updates to function smoothly and securely. Apple’s MagSafe 3 charging cable is no exception and a new update is designed to address any security concerns and improve the user experience.

While Apple hasn’t provided any concrete details about the update, industry experts expect the new version to resolve any charging issues, improve battery life, and provide more reliable connections between devices and cables. Firmware updates are also commonly used to improve compatibility with other devices and systems.

The update will automatically install on your device as soon as the charging cable is connected to your Mac. Users do not need to take any action to install the update; However, to ensure the best experience, users are encouraged to keep their devices updated with the latest firmware.

What is the firmware update for the USB-C to MagSafe 3 charging cable?

Apple has released a firmware update for the 2-meter USB-C to MagSafe 3 charging cable. It is currently unclear what the update does or fixes.

How do I install the firmware update?

The firmware update automatically installs on the cable as soon as it is plugged into a MacBook.
